Carer's Allowance Eligibility

Dáil Éireann Debate, Tuesday - 2 April 2019

Tuesday, 2 April 2019

Ceisteanna (532)

Bernard Durkan

Ceist:

532. Deputy Bernard J. Durkan asked the Minister for Employment Affairs and Social Protection if she will review eligibility for a carer's allowance in the case of a person (details supplied); and if she will make a statement on the matter. [14821/19]

Amharc ar fhreagra

Freagraí scríofa

My department received an application for carer’s allowance (CA) from the person concerned on 4 December 2018.  Carer's allowance (CA) is a means-tested social assistance payment, made to persons who are providing full-time care and attention to a person who has such a disability that they require that level of care.

The evidence submitted in support of this application was examined and the deciding officer decided that although a certain level of care was being provided the level involved did not amount to full-time care.

The person concerned was notified on 1 March 2019 of this decision, the reason for it and of her right of review and appeal.

I hope this clarifies the matter for the Deputy.
